Xinxin Yao, the No. 398-ranked wildcard and home favorite from China, faces No. 338 Haruka Kaji of Japan in the WTA 125 Jiangxi Open round of 16 on hard courts at Jiujiang International Tennis Center. Kaji enters with momentum after upsetting higher-ranked Xinyu Gao (No. 221) in the previous round, showcasing strong return play, while Yao advanced past qualifier Hong Yi Cody Wong. Their head-to-head stands at 1-1 from ITF Hong Kong matches last year, highlighting stylistic balance on hard courts. No injuries or withdrawals reported; traders weigh Kaji's experience against Yao's youth, crowd support, and surface familiarity in this evenly matched affair.
